Ingredients List

For this buffalo chicken dip you’ll need:

  • 2 cups cooked chicken breast, shredded
  • 8 ounces cream cheese, softened
  • ½ cup ranch dressing
  • ½ cup buffalo hot sauce
  • 1½ cups shredded cheddar cheese
  • ½ cup blue cheese crumbles
  • 2 tablespoons butter
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• Optional: ¼ cup green onions, sliced
  • Optional: ½ teaspoon smoked paprika
  • Tortilla chips, celery sticks, and crackers for serving

Timing

This buffalo chicken dip requires:

  • Preparation time: 10 minutes
  • Cooking time: 20-25 minutes
  • Total time: 30-35 minutes

Step-by-Step Instructions

Step 1: Prepare the Chicken Base

If starting with raw chicken, poach or bake chicken breasts until cooked through with an internal temperature of 165°F, then shred using two forks or a hand mixer on low speed. Alternatively, use rotisserie chicken for time-saving convenience. Ensure the chicken is finely shredded rather than chunked—smaller pieces distribute better throughout the dip and create superior texture in every bite of your buffalo chicken dip.

Step 2: Create the Creamy Foundation

Preheat your oven to 350°F. In a medium saucepan over low heat, melt butter and sauté minced garlic for 1 minute until fragrant. Add softened cream cheese and stir continuously until melted and smooth, about 3-4 minutes. The cream cheese should be completely lump-free before proceeding. This creates the rich, creamy base that holds everything together while providing luxurious texture.

Step 3: Mix the Key Ingredients

Remove the saucepan from heat and stir in ranch dressing, buffalo hot sauce, and 1 cup of shredded cheddar cheese. Mix until the cheese melts and all ingredients combine into a smooth, cohesive sauce. The mixture should be pourable but thick—if it seems too thin, return briefly to low heat to thicken. Fold in the shredded chicken, ensuring every piece is coated with the creamy buffalo sauce.

Step 4: Assemble for Baking

Transfer the chicken mixture to a 9-inch baking dish or cast iron skillet, spreading it evenly to the edges. Sprinkle the remaining cheddar cheese and blue cheese crumbles over the top, creating a generous cheese layer that will become golden and bubbly. The double cheese topping adds both visual appeal and flavor intensity to your buffalo chicken dip.

Step 5: Bake to Perfection

Place the dish in the preheated oven and bake for 20-25 minutes until the dip is bubbling around the edges and the cheese topping turns golden brown. For extra browning, place under the broiler for the final 2-3 minutes, watching carefully to prevent burning. The dip should be hot throughout with a slightly caramelized cheese crust on top.

Step 6: Garnish and Serve

Remove from the oven and let rest for 5 minutes to allow the dip to set slightly—this prevents it from being too runny when served. Garnish with sliced green onions and a sprinkle of smoked paprika for color and additional flavor. Serve hot with tortilla chips, celery sticks, crackers, or toasted baguette slices arranged around the dish for easy dipping.

Healthier Alternatives for the Recipe

Transform your buffalo chicken dip into a healthier version with these modifications:

  • Replace full-fat cream cheese with reduced-fat or Greek cream cheese to cut saturated fat by approximately 40%
  • Use Greek yogurt instead of half the cream cheese for added protein and probiotic benefits
  • Substitute light ranch dressing or make homemade with Greek yogurt base to reduce calories
  • Choose reduced-fat cheddar and eliminate blue cheese to lower overall fat content
  • Add diced celery and carrots directly into the dip for extra vegetables and fiber
  • Use turkey breast instead of chicken for leaner protein with similar taste
  • Replace half the hot sauce with plain Greek yogurt to reduce sodium while maintaining creaminess
  • Serve with vegetable sticks, bell pepper strips, and cucumber slices instead of chips to reduce empty calories

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Master this buffalo chicken dip by avoiding these pitfalls:

  • Using cold cream cheese: Firm cream cheese creates lumps that won’t incorporate smoothly—always bring to room temperature or soften gently
  • Overseasoning with hot sauce: Too much buffalo sauce creates overwhelming heat that masks other flavors—start with recommended amount and adjust
  • Skipping the bake time: Unheated dip lacks depth and proper cheese melt—always bake even if ingredients seem ready
  • Dry chicken: Using overcooked or unseasoned chicken creates bland spots—ensure chicken is moist and well-incorporated
  • Serving immediately: Hot dip straight from oven is too runny and burns mouths—allow 5 minutes to set before serving
  • Wrong baking dish size: Too large spreads dip thin and dries it out, too small causes overflow—use recommended 9-inch dish
  • Not stirring while melting: Unattended cream cheese scorches on the bottom—stir constantly for smooth consistency

Storing Tips for the Recipe

Preserve the freshness of your buffalo chicken dip with these strategies:

  • Refrigerator storage: Store covered in an airtight container for up to 4 days—the flavors actually improve after 24 hours
  • Reheating method: Warm in a 350°F oven for 15-20 minutes, stirring halfway through, or microwave in 30-second intervals stirring between
  • Freezing option: Freeze uncooked dip in a freezer-safe container for up to 3 months—thaw overnight in refrigerator before baking
  • Make-ahead strategy: Assemble completely up to 2 days ahead and refrigerate unbaked, then bake when ready to serve
  • Portion control: Divide into smaller containers before storing for easy single-serving reheating
  • Texture maintenance: Add a splash of milk or cream when reheating if dip seems dry or stiff
  • Slow cooker serving: Transfer to slow cooker on low or warm setting to keep hot for extended serving periods without drying out

FAQs

Can I make buffalo chicken dip in a slow cooker? Absolutely! Combine all ingredients in the slow cooker, stir well, and cook on low for 2-3 hours or high for 1-1.5 hours, stirring occasionally until hot and bubbly.

What’s the best way to adjust the spice level in buffalo chicken dip? For milder dip, reduce hot sauce and increase ranch dressing. For spicier versions, add extra hot sauce or cayenne pepper. Always taste and adjust before baking.

Can I use canned chicken for this recipe? Yes, though fresh or rotisserie chicken provides better texture and flavor. If using canned, drain thoroughly and flake well to achieve proper consistency throughout the dip.

Can I make buffalo chicken dip dairy-free? Yes, use dairy-free cream cheese, dairy-free ranch dressing, and dairy-free cheese shreds. Nutritional yeast can add cheesy flavor. The taste differs slightly but remains delicious.

Why is my buffalo chicken dip watery? Common causes include too much hot sauce, not draining chicken properly, or using low-fat dairy products that release moisture. Drain all ingredients well and use full-fat dairy for best consistency.

How long can buffalo chicken dip sit out at room temperature? For food safety, don’t leave at room temperature longer than 2 hours. Keep warm in a slow cooker or chafing dish, or refrigerate and reheat as needed during long events.
